Potentially toxic element accumulation in two Equisetum species spontaneously grown in the flotation tailings

Decades of mining activity have resulted in the accumulation significant amounts tailings that are deposited over natural vegetation, forming deposits tens meters thick. The poor organic matter and macronutrients contain a high concentration potentially toxic elements (PTE). Their surface remains unvegetated for long periods time is susceptible to fluvial wind erosion. Equisetum arvense E. telmateia appear be first colonizers Pb-Cu-Zn mine Serbia. Each plant was sampled along with its associated substrate. Pseudototal available metals substrate, as well total As, Cd, Cu, Fe, Mn, Ni, Pb Zn concentrations parts were determined by atomic absorption spectrophotometry. findings show both species bioaccumulation capacity tolerance otherwise due efficient accumulation, immobilization, detoxification these their underground parts. It expected long-term presence metal-tolerant horsetail would increase content flotation residues, thus gradually improving physical, chemical, biological properties. This, turn, promote succession other soil microorganisms.
